If the Lanternmill template-rendering benchmark stage exceeds its 90-second budget, first check whether the partial cache was warmed; a cold cache roughly triples render time on the Verity suite. Re-run the stage once before escalating, since the Dovefield runners occasionally start throttled. When filing a report, always include the build token, which for this note appears below.

pipeline stamp: htk3_cc5

## Build Provenance: Payroll Export v3 (Tallygrove)

Hey, new folks — quick context. When we moved the payroll export from fixed-width to the new columnar format, Finance insisted every exported file be traceable back to the exact exporter build. So the pipeline now stamps provenance into the file footer and our build system records it at compile time. If someone asks "which exporter made this file," you look up the token shown below.

build token for tawip-yageg: htk9_92ac43d42

### Webhook Retry Semantics — Hollowgate

Hollowgate retries failed webhook deliveries with exponential backoff: 1m, 5m, 30m, then hourly for 24 hours. A 2xx stops retries; 410 disables the endpoint. Support can replay events manually via the internal replay console. Replay requests must authenticate against the internal dispatch service using the key below.

service key, kaduf-bawig: kto15_Ze79S0dligTw0yO

Subject: Planner cut-over done — plugin author notes

Hello plugin authors — the cut-over to the Ledgewise v9 query planner completed this morning. The regression that inflated join cardinality estimates on partitioned tables is resolved, and hinting plugins no longer need the workaround flags from the advisory. Please re-run your conformance suites against v9 before re-publishing. The planner now starts with the settings shown below.

settings of fafog-haduf:
ZORIX_PIN=4648
ZORIX_METRICS_HOST=metrics.zorix.paliqsys.corp
ZORIX_LOG_LEVEL=info
ZORIX_TENANT=druix